Caption Ultrastructural changes in hepatocytes of Abcb11tm1Wng/Abcb11tm1Wng mice. A: Canalicular changes in hepatocytes in Abcb11tm1Wng/Abcb11tm1Wng mice at 6 weeks of age. Bile canaliculus (*) in center of micrograph shows dilated lumen, partial loss of microvilli (arrowhead), and retained biliary material in the form of lamellar and more membranous appearing "fingerprints." B: Cytoplasmic changes in hepatocytes of homozygous mutant mice at 6 weeks of age. Note abundance of peroxisomes (p) and frequent small lipid droplets (L). Peroxisomes are thought to be the site of bile acid metabolism and modification (51). Mitochondria and other organelles are normal as is the hepatic sinusoid(s). C: Hepatocytes of wild type mice at 6 weeks of age. Part of two cells is shown with bile canaliculus (bc). Occasional lipid droplets and an abundance of glycogen (gly) are seen. Part of a normal stellate (Ito) cell is also present. g, Golgi.
